I feel this poem was more like a transforming poem both for yeats and for the readers. The poem uses the word gold here which can be taken as a symbol of peace but if we look from another perspective it will not be wrong to say that the recurring word gold or golden can be a modern world which only keeps floating on the artificial shine or glamour. Gold is a metal which captures the beauty of the buyer and so the poet wants to be captured just like the gold so that people don't forget him. He tries hard to be remembered though the nature of the world is to be forgotten. Thank you ma'am for this amazing explanation ❤🌈
